So I saw this idea on www.bystephanielynn.com. She has a great blog with lots of cooking and decorating ideas. She saw it on Martha Stewart's website.
You take a small pumpkin and carve it. Martha's had cute little circles all over, but I did a face. Then you take ground cinnamon and rub it on the lid (I added a bit of ground ginger too; Martha says you can also stick cloves in the lid). Light a little tea light and insert!
Your house will smell like you have been baking pies all day! I have lots of pumpkins this year and I bet you can guess what I will be doing when guests come over.
